¿Cuánto cuesta alquilar un apartamento en Currie?
| Dormitorios | Precio Promedio | Más barato | Más caro |
|---|---|---|---|
| Apartamentos Estudio en Currie | $896 | $599 | $1,155 |
| Apartamentos 1 Dormitorios en Currie | $1,109 | $595 | $1,980 |
| Apartamentos 2 Dormitorios en Currie | $1,321 | $625 | $2,100 |
| Apartamentos 3 Dormitorios en Currie | $1,661 | $1,150 | $1,960 |
| Apartamentos 4 Dormitorios en Currie | $1,567 | $1,350 | $1,785 |
